After you make an application for a mortgage, you1ll will need to make your mind up how much time your amortization period will probably be - This can be the amount of a long time it will eventually choose you to definitely repay your mortgage in complete. If your deposit is twenty% of the purchase price of the property or maybe more, you may decide on around a 30-calendar year amortization. For anyone who is putting down below 20%, the maximum allowable amortization interval drops to twenty five several years - and you will also need mortgage default coverage. You may take into account a shorter amortization Should your goal should be to repay your mortgage quicker. With a shorter amortization you can cut costs simply because you'll spend fewer fascination over the lifetime of the mortgage. The trade-off Here's that your common mortgage payment are going to be bigger. On the flip side, with a longer amortization, real estate appraisal your payments will be decreased, but it can get more time to repay your mortgage, and your full interest price will likely be greater. It really arrives down to balancing Anything you're comfortable with from the payment viewpoint with what your aim is for the length of time it's going to get to pay for your mortgage off.
